Design

A beautiful revolution for the roads

The Design Center was the first of its kind in Korea to independently focus on automotive design.
Today, it leads global trends with designs that harmonize people and their emotions. To predict global design trends and study lifestyles in regional markets, we are building a global design network connecting major cities in the US, Europe, Japan and newly emerging economies.
The Design Center will spearhead even more original and innovative designs to raise our profile as a global leading automaker.

DESIGN PROCESS

DESIGN PROCESS Disign planning Sketching and rendering 1/4scale modeling Digital(CAS) modeling Digital visual evaluation(virtual reality presentation) 1:1 scale clay modeling Emotional and color design
1. Design planning
Data Research and Analysis - Image
Data Research and Analysis
Objective

- Predict future styling trends.
- Research for new & unique aesthetics.

Methodology

- Analyze competitors' models.
- Analyze styling trends through the motor shows and other events.
- Analyze lifestyles (image map production).
- Analyze style positioning maps.

Different units in the Design Research Center work together to predict the future design trends and devise the automobile packaging for future models.
2. Sketching and rendering
Idea Sketch - Image
Idea Sketch
Objective

- Propose preliminary ideas for creating a concrete image of the target car model.

Methodology

- Designers use colored pencils, markers and other tools to draft concrete images of the future shapes they envision.

As the first in the styling process the idea sketch is very important. 80-90% of the design direction will be decided in this stage.

Rendering
Objective

- Suggest the concrete design image for 2D design evaluation.

Methodology

- Consider the proportions of the side, front and rear view in order to express the image in sense of realism.

Rendering: Designs are assessed at this stage. Package sketches of the side, front and rear provided by the design engineers are evaluated in technical and legal standpoints to develop the design for use in a real world.

6. 1:1 scale clay modeling
1/1 Tape Drawing - Image
1/1 Tape Drawing
Objective

- A design diagram is created to produce the full-scale model. At the same time, the design can be studied in its actual size.

Methodology

- Line tape is used to represent the side, front and rear view of a design diagram in full scale.

Full-scale Rendering
The draft design is enlarged to full-scale size, but most of the details are abbreviated.
Full-scale Tape Drawing
A design diagram is drawn so that a full-scale model can be made. As with the 1/4-scale tape drawing, the sketches are done while simultaneously checking the side, front, rear and top views.

1/1 Modeling - Image
1/1 Modeling
Objective

- A full-scale 3D model is produced for design assessment and engineering inspection.

Methodology

- The 3D (body) model and various trim pieces are crafted out of clay.

Full-scale Modeling
At this stage, a 3D model is created to allow inspection of engineering aspects and to assess the design. A low-deformation resin material is shaped and then painted to give the concept a more realistic image and feel. Detailed mock-ups of the trim pieces are also made and attached to the body to complete the full-scale model.

7. Emotional and color design
Color and Seat Design - Image
Color and Seat Design

- Color designs are included in the initial product plan, and the work is carried out at the same time as styling. This involves not only the colors adorning the interior and exterior, but also all the areas related to materials, including embossing and surface treatment.
